SpaceX's Crew-9 astronaut flight for NASA launches this week. Here's how it turned into a rescue mission
SpaceX's Crew-9 mission to the International Space Station on Sept. 26 will be a rescue mission of sorts, bringing up empty seats for two NASA astronauts currently in space without a ride home.

SpaceX Crew-9’s duo arrive to Kennedy Space Center ahead of launch
Only two of the original four members of SpaceX Crew-9’s mission to the International Space Station arrived to Kennedy Space Center on Saturday, making room on their future ride home next year for the pair of NASA astronauts left behind by Boeing’s Starliner.
